@ -0,0 +1,98 @@
# -*- coding: utf-8 -*-
import hashlib
import os
from codecs import open
from tempfile import mkdtemp
from shutil import rmtree
from pelican import Pelican
from pelican.settings import read_settings
from .support import unittest, skipIfNoExecutable, module_exists
CUR_DIR = os.path.dirname(__file__)
@unittest.skipUnless(module_exists('webassets'), "webassets isn't installed")
@skipIfNoExecutable(['scss', '-v'])
@skipIfNoExecutable(['cssmin', '--version'])
class TestWebAssets(unittest.TestCase):
def setUp(self):
"""Run pelican with two settings (absolute and relative urls)."""
self.theme_dir = os.path.join(CUR_DIR, 'themes', 'assets')
self.temp_path = mkdtemp()
self.settings = read_settings(override={
'PATH': os.path.join(CUR_DIR, 'content', 'TestCategory'),
'OUTPUT_PATH': self.temp_path,
'PLUGINS': ['pelican.plugins.assets', ],
'THEME': self.theme_dir,
})
pelican = Pelican(settings=self.settings)
pelican.run()
# run Pelican a second time with absolute urls
self.temp_path2 = mkdtemp()
self.settings2 = read_settings(override={
'PATH': os.path.join(CUR_DIR, 'content', 'TestCategory'),
'OUTPUT_PATH': self.temp_path2,
'PLUGINS': ['pelican.plugins.assets', ],
'THEME': self.theme_dir,
'RELATIVE_URLS': False,
'SITEURL': 'http://localhost'
})
pelican2 = Pelican(settings=self.settings2)
pelican2.run()
self.css_ref = open(os.path.join(self.theme_dir, 'static', 'css',
'style.min.css')).read()
self.version = hashlib.md5(self.css_ref).hexdigest()[0:8]
def tearDown(self):
rmtree(self.temp_path)
rmtree(self.temp_path2)
def test_jinja2_ext(self):
"""Test that the Jinja2 extension was correctly added."""
from webassets.ext.jinja2 import AssetsExtension
self.assertIn(AssetsExtension, self.settings['JINJA_EXTENSIONS'])
def test_compilation(self):
"""Compare the compiled css with the reference."""
gen_file = os.path.join(self.temp_path, 'theme', 'gen',
'style.{0}.min.css'.format(self.version))
self.assertTrue(os.path.isfile(gen_file))
css_new = open(gen_file).read()
self.assertEqual(css_new, self.css_ref)
def check_link_tag(self, css_file, html_file):
"""Check the presence of `css_file` in `html_file`."""
link_tag = '<link rel="stylesheet" href="{css_file}">'.\
format(css_file=css_file)
html = open(html_file).read()
self.assertRegexpMatches(html, link_tag)
def test_template(self):
"""Look in the output index.html file for the link tag."""
css_file = 'theme/gen/style.{0}.min.css'.format(self.version)
html_files = ['index.html', 'archives.html',
'this-is-an-article-with-category.html']
for f in html_files:
self.check_link_tag(css_file, os.path.join(self.temp_path, f))
def test_absolute_url(self):
"""Look in the output index.html file for the link tag with abs url."""
css_file = 'http://localhost/theme/gen/style.{0}.min.css'.\
format(self.version)
html_files = ['index.html', 'archives.html',
'this-is-an-article-with-category.html']
for f in html_files:
self.check_link_tag(css_file, os.path.join(self.temp_path2, f))
